Chichagof Harbor is an inlet on the northeast coast of Attu Island in Alaska’s Aleutian Islands. It was named for Russian Admiral and explorer Vasily Chichagov. The harbor area included an Aleut village that was served by an American pastor and his wife. In World War II, it saw heavy fighting during the Battle of Attu as American forces recaptured the island from Japan, and later housed Battery B of the 42nd Coast Artillery Battalion.
